WWE To Make Major U-Turn With Released Star?

This released wrestler could be on their way back to WWE imminently.

Sarah Logan could soon find herself back on WWE's payroll.

This is according to Sean Ross Sapp of Fightful, who reports that a number of people within the company have "loudly went to bat for her" since she was let go last week, leading to backstage speculation that the promotion is on the verge of performing a U-turn with her.

Logan was let go as part of WWE's mass Black Wednesday releases on 15 April, just two days after her Raw loss to Shayna Baszler. Former stablemate Ruby Riott mentioned her in a promo on last night's show, which is unusual for somebody who has just been let go, and Sarah has another major tie to WWE in the form of husband Erik of The Viking Raiders.

Signed to a full developmental contract in October 2016, Logan graduated to WWE's main roster alongside Riott and Liv Morgan 13 months later, though she had struggled for momentum since the group's split in 2018. Baszler had bested her in less than a minute.

Last night's Raw was preceded by a Ryan Satin report that one of WWE's released wrestlers was set for a shock appearance on the show, though this never came to pass.
